site stats

Flink yarn application mode

WebIf you do want to use YARN cli for running Flink applications, it >> is possible to check JM's log with the YARN command like: >> *yarn logs -applicationId application_xxx_yyy -am -1 -logFiles >> jobmanager.log* >> For TM log, command would be like: >> * yarn logs -applicationId -containerId >> -logFiles taskmanager.log ... WebApr 22, 2024 · There are two types of cluster deployment modes: Standalone and YARN. Single Runtime: Apache Flink Stream has a single runtime environment that can handle both stream and batch processing. As a result, the runtime system may support a wide range of applications with the same implementation.

How to get get Application Id in submitting Flink jobs …

WebMay 5, 2024 · In Flink 1.15, we have introduced a new execution mode named ’thread’ mode, for which Python user-defined functions will be executed in the JVM as a thread instead of a separate Python process. Benchmarks have shown that throughput could be increased by 2x in common scenarios such as JSON processing. WebYARN automatically kills application containers that use more memory than their allocated limit. To avoid Flink TaskManagers getting killed by YARN use the following calculation to set the size: TM total size = TM Heap + Heap-cutoff. The default heap cutoff is 25% and it is also configurable. goals in south gate https://dslamacompany.com

2024.04.13-Flink - 知乎 - 知乎专栏

Webbut if i set `execution.target: yarn-per-job` in flink-conf.yaml, it runs ok if i run in application mode, it runs ok too ./bin/flink run-application -p 2 -d -t yarn-application -ytm 3g -yjm 3g -yD yarn.provided.lib.dirs=hdfs:///flink/flink-1.12-SNAPSHOT/lib ./examples/streaming/StateMachineExample.jar WebApr 13, 2024 · Flink on top of YARN. A Flink application consists of two major unit- one Jobmanager and multiple Taskmanagers. ... mode. In this mode, the JobManager preserves it’s state in HDFS and saves a pointer to that state in zookeeper. On crash, YARN will launch a new Application Master which will deploy the job again and resume from … WebFeb 10, 2024 · Flink has supported resource management systems like YARN and Mesos since the early days; however, these were not designed for the fast-moving cloud-native … goals international trucking dallas

大数据Flink进阶(十三):Flink 任务提交模式 - 腾讯云开发者社 …

Category:Flink运行模式_软件运维_内存溢出

Tags:Flink yarn application mode

Flink yarn application mode

YARN Apache Flink

WebOct 15, 2024 · When running Flink on Dataproc, we use YARN as resource manager for Flink. You can run Flink jobs in 2 ways: job cluster and session cluster. For the job cluster, YARN will create... WebApr 7, 2024 · 序言 Flink 是一个分布式系统,需要有效分配和管理计算资源才能执行流应用程序。(这句话很重要,资源计算,资源的分配不是Flink当前强 …

Flink yarn application mode

Did you know?

WebApr 11, 2024 · 在将作业提交到 Kubernetes 集群之前,应该首先设置一些 Kubernetes 配置选项,例如集群 ID,Flink Kubernetes 客户端的作业命名空间,以及上传作业所需的资源。 使用 Flink Kubernetes 客户端创建 ClusterClientProvider,用于从 Kubernetes 集群中获取 … WebIn this mode Flink interpreter runs in the JobManager which is in yarn container. In order to run Flink in yarn application mode, you need to make the following settings: Set flink.execution.mode to be yarn-application; Set HADOOP_CONF_DIR in Flink's interpreter setting or zeppelin-env.sh. Make sure hadoop command is on your PATH.

WebYou have the following mode in which you can run your Flink jobs: Per-job mode Per-job mode means that you run the Flink job in a dedaction YARN application. In this case … WebOct 8, 2024 · 长久以来,在YARN集群中部署Flink作业有两种模式,即Session Mode和Per-Job Mode,而在Flink 1.11版本中,又引入了第三种全新的模式:Application Mode。 本 …

WebOur jobs are basically SQL scripts so we >>> have some custom Java code to leverage Flink's SQL and Table API to build >>> the execution environment and execute the jobs on Yarn. We would like to >>> keep the current flow in our platform so we are looking for a way to run >>> Flink SQL in application mode via some Java code. WebFlink provides a Command-Line Interface (CLI) bin/flink to run programs that are packaged as JAR files and to control their execution. The CLI is part of any Flink setup, available …

WebApplication Mode will launch a Flink cluster on YARN, where the main() method of the application jar gets executed on the JobManager in YARN. The cluster will shut down as …

WebWhen a Flink job is submitted to YARN, the JobManager's host and the number of available processing slots is written into a properties file, so that the Flink client is able to pick those details up. This configuration parameter allows changing the default location of that goals in strategic planningWebIn this mode flink interpreter runs in the JobManager which is in yarn container. In order to run flink in yarn application mode, you need to make the following settings: Set … goals internationalWeb问题 Flink内核升级到1.3.0之后,当Kafka调用带有非static的KafkaPartitioner类对象为参数的FlinkKafkaProducer010去构造函数时,运行时会报错。 ... -client和yarn-cluster模式在提交任务时setAppName的执行顺序不同导致,yarn-client中setAppName是在向yarn注册Application之前读取,yarn-cluser ... goals in swimmingWebApache Flink 1.12 Documentation: Apache Hadoop YARN This documentation is for an out-of-date version of Apache Flink. We recommend you use the latest stable version. v1.12 … goals in teaching languageWebApr 8, 2024 · Flink 任务提交模式. Flink分布式计算框架可以基于多种模式部署,每种部署模式下提交任务都有相应的资源管理方式,例如:Flink可以基于Standalone部署模式、基于Yarn部署模式、基于Kubernetes部署模式运行任务,以上不同的集群部署模式下提交Flink任务会涉及申请资源、各角色交互过程,不同模式申请 ... goals in spanish meansWebA new CLI command where the user will be able to launch jobs in “Application Mode". In the first version, this new command will be available for Yarn and in order to launch an application in this mode, the user will be able to write: bin/flink run-application .... with the rest of the options being the same as before. Potential Future Features goals in studying psychologyWebMay 6, 2024 · You have now started a Flink job in Reactive Mode. The web interface shows that the job is running on one TaskManager. If you want to scale up the job, simply add another TaskManager to the cluster: # Start additional TaskManager ./bin/taskmanager.sh start. To scale down, remove a TaskManager instance: # Remove a TaskManager … bondo filler for bumper covers